You have to keep up with it.

But for most houses, it’s not an issue doing so.

Your landlord’s barn is a different issue. Flat roofs are in more danger of collapsing, but are also easier and safer to clear.

Insulation goes a long way to preventing ice build up thus allowing for easier shoveling.
